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Schaltfläche farbig Makro

Schaltfläche farbig Makro
Rest
Hallo
Ich habe eine Schaltfläche (steuerelement) mit der kann ich auf einem anderen Tabellenblatt eine Zeile ein oder ausblenden.
Nun meine Frage:
Gibt es eine Möglichkeit wenn ausgeblendet, dass die Schaltfläche rot ist und wenn eingeblendet die Schaltfläche grün ist.
Gruss Reto
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Schaltfläche farbig Makro
20.08.2011 11:35:15
Josef

Hallo Reto,
das geht z. B. so.
Private Sub CommandButton1_Click()
  With CommandButton1
    If .BackColor = RGB(0, 255, 0) Then
      .BackColor = RGB(255, 0, 0)
      Sheets("Tabelle2").Rows(15).Hidden = True
    Else
      .BackColor = RGB(0, 255, 0)
      Sheets("Tabelle2").Rows(15).Hidden = False
    End If
  End With
End Sub



« Gruß Sepp »

Anzeige
AW: Schaltfläche farbig Makro
20.08.2011 12:45:30
Rest
Hallo
Irgendwie funktioniert das noch nicht so richtig.
Mein Makro sieht folgendermassen aus:
Private Sub Cmd1_Click()
Cmd1.Caption = Range("A23").Value
Sheets("JanDez").Rows("5:5").EntireRow.Hidden = Not _
Sheets("JanDez").Rows("5:5").EntireRow.Hidden
End Sub
Wie muss ich deine Hilfe integrieren ?
Danke und Gruss
Reto
Anzeige
AW: Schaltfläche farbig Makro
20.08.2011 13:29:06
Josef

Hallo Reto,
das würde ich so lösen.
Private Sub Cmd1_Click()
  
  Cmd1.Caption = Range("A23").Value
  
  With Sheets("JanDez")
    .Rows(5).Hidden = Not .Rows(5).Hidden
    
    Cmd1.BackColor = IIf(.Rows(5).Hidden, RGB(255, 0, 0), RGB(0, 255, 0))
  End With
  
End Sub



« Gruß Sepp »

Anzeige
AW: Schaltfläche farbig Makro
20.08.2011 17:23:40
Rest
Hallo
Merci 1000.
Das habe ich gesucht. Besten Dank für die Hilfe.
So jetzt kann ich wieder weiter arbeiten. Danke und ein schönes Wochenende.
Gruss Reto Danke
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ige